corvette 113 heads
does anyone know if the vette 113 heads will except, without mods the old style sbc intake? also what intake gasket would i need? the vette uses a differant one from the regular sbc. any help would be great thanks

NOT TRUE!
The 113's have the '86-earlier bolt angles/pattern. They were used on the ZZ3 & ZZ4 crate engine, and that intake has all 90 degree bolt holes (have one of those manifolds on Berlinetta #1).
